Abstract

The present invention is a kind of blood pressure measuring device, the main frame that blood pressure measuring device comprises oversleeve and is connected with oversleeve, upstream air bag and downstream air bag lay respectively at the upstream and downstream of tested limb artery blood flow, downstream air bag is for detecting the change information of pulse signal, the change of the blood flow pulse that real-time sensing is changed by the pressure of upstream air bag and produces, Microprocessor S3C44B0X air pump, gas bleeder valve and process detect the force value in one or two in upstream air bag and downstream air bag respectively or simultaneously by one or two in the first pressure transducer and the second pressure transducer, pulse signal, or force value and pulse signal.The device of Measure blood pressure provided by the invention is that colligation two inflatable bladders pressurize on limbs, effectively detects pressure wherein and pulse signal, thus accurately, reliably Measure blood pressure, and measurement result is stablized.

Technical field
The invention belongs to technical field of medical instruments, particularly relate to a kind of method detecting arterial blood pulse signal and the blood pressure measuring device using the method, especially a kind of pass through two inflatable bladders a body part blood flow upstream and downstream simultaneously detected pressures and pulse signal method and in this approach based on blood pressure measuring device.
Background technology
One of method that blood pressure measurement is the most frequently used adopts a kind of cuff with an inflatable bladders, first human body limb artery blood flow is blocked by pressurization, then slowly reduce pressure, in decompression process, the Korotkoff's Sound produced during by detecting blood flow by blocking district, or the information such as the strong and weak changing value of the pulse wave signal that produces in cuff of arterial pressure, determine systolic pressure and the diastolic pressure of arterial blood.China Patent No. CN201010247968.6, the patent documentation that title is " a kind of Woundless blood pressure measuring device and measuring method thereof " describes a kind of pulse wave probe that uses and detects cuff downstream arterial pulse signal, thus determines the sphygomanometer of systolic pressure and diastolic pressure.This pulse wave probe detects cuff downstream arterial pulse signal by pressure inductor or photoelectric sensor.China Patent No. is CN201220159276.0, the patent documentation that title is " a kind of double bolloon bandage " describes a kind of binary articulated double bolloon oversleeve, described cuff has upstream air bag bandage body and downstream air bag bandage body, and described upstream air bag bandage body and described downstream air bag bandage body are be fixedly connected with within 30cm according to artery blood flow direction spacing.Described downstream air bag bandage body for detecting tested limbs downstream blood liquid stream moving pulse, and determines the pressure of tested limb artery blood with this.
Prior art not yet solves upstream and downstream air bag bandage and should pressurize by which kind of mode and be pressurized to which kind of degree of pressure, the blood flow pulse that can be used for measuring tested limbs blood pressure could be detected most effectively in upstream and downstream air bag bandage, thus accurately, the problem of reliably Measure blood pressure.
Summary of the invention
In order to solve the problem, the invention provides a kind of accurate, reliable sphygomanometer, a kind of two inflatable bladders to colligation on limbs are particularly provided to carry out pneumatic compression, effectively to detect the method for pulse signal wherein, and use the device of the method Measurement accuracy sphygomanometer.

A kind of blood pressure measuring device of the present invention, measuring device is used for measuring arteriotony by measured's body part, and measuring device comprises:
Two aerating gasbag upstream air bags and downstream air bag; Upstream air bag and downstream air bag are in same cuff or in two different cufves be connected or in two different cufves be not connected, and cuff is for being bundled in tested limbs;
Two with one or two pressure transducer first pressure transducer be connected respectively or simultaneously in upstream air bag and downstream air bag and the second pressure transducer;
A microprocessor, microprocessor performs the blood pressure measurement comprised the following steps:
A) by downstream gasbag pressurizes to the force value of between tested systolic arterial pressure and diastolic pressure, or the mean blood pressure value of tested tremulous pulse subtracts 10mmHg and average pressure value and adds a force value between 20mmHg, or a force value, makes the pulse signal amplitude detected in the air bag of downstream when this force value be greater than a set-point;
B) upstream air bag is pressurized to a force value higher than tested systolic arterial pressure;
C) upstream air bag is slowly lost heart, in the slow bleeding process of upstream air bag, the air pressure of constantly change in the air bag of upstream is measured by the first pressure transducer, and measure the pulse signal in the air bag of downstream by the second pressure transducer simultaneously, according to the relation between the air pressure in described pulse signal and upstream air bag, determine tested systolic arterial pressure.
Further improvement of the present invention is: in steps A) in, in the process to downstream gasbag pressurizes by a force value between downstream gasbag pressurizes to the systolic pressure and diastolic pressure of tested tremulous pulse and method that downstream gasbag pressurizes is subtracted to the mean blood pressure value of tested tremulous pulse the force value that 10mmHg and average pressure value add between 20mmHg, pulse signal in the air bag of real-time detection downstream, when pulse signal amplitude is increased to maximum by zero, when then starting to decline, stop pressurization; With by downstream gasbag pressurizes to a force value, with the method making the pulse signal amplitude detected in the air bag of downstream when this force value be greater than a set-point be, by in the process to downstream gasbag pressurizes, pulse signal in the air bag of real-time detection downstream entrained by air pressure signal, when pulse signal amplitude by zero be increased to be greater than set-point time, stop pressurization.
In steps A) in, pulse signal amplitude set-point is a value between 1.3mmHg to 1.8mmHg, is preferably 1.5mmHg.
In step B) in, by upstream air bag, the method be pressurized to higher than a force value of tested systolic arterial pressure is, in the process to described upstream gasbag pressurizes, the change of the pulse signal amplitude in the air bag of Real-Time Monitoring downstream, when the pulse signal amplitude in the air bag of described downstream with the increase of the air pressure of described upstream air bag from diminishing greatly, when finally disappearing, stop pressurization.
Further improvement of the present invention is: by downstream gasbag pressurizes to a force value, the method making the pulse signal amplitude detected in the air bag of downstream when this force value be greater than a set-point is, downstream air bag segmentation is pressurizeed, and after each section of pressurization terminates, detect the pulse signal in the air bag of downstream, when pulse signal amplitude is greater than set-point, stop pressurization, to the segmented objects of downstream air bag segmentation pressurization be: 80mmHg, 120mmHg, 160mmHg and 200mmHg.
Further improvement of the present invention is: in step C) in, in the slow bleeding process of upstream air bag, the air pressure of constantly change in the air bag of upstream is measured by the first pressure transducer, and the time of origin of first pulse signal in the air bag of downstream is measured by the second pressure transducer, air pressure when occurring according to described first pulse signal in the air bag of upstream, determines tested systolic arterial pressure.
Further improvement of the present invention is: in step C) in the slow bleeding process of upstream air bag, the air pressure of constantly change in the air bag of upstream is measured by the first pressure transducer, and amplitude and the time of origin of first and second pulse signal in the air bag of downstream is measured by the second pressure transducer, atmospheric pressure value when described first and second pulse signal occur in upstream air bag (1), determines tested arterial blood systolic pressure.

Embodiment one, use decompression method measure systolic pressure pulse signal method and measuring device
The present invention is a kind of blood pressure measuring device, the main frame 4 that described blood pressure measuring device comprises oversleeve 8 and is connected with described oversleeve 8, described oversleeve 8 is the fan-shaped oversleeves of double bolloon, the fan-shaped oversleeve of described double bolloon is the cuff be bundled on tested limbs of two gas cells of the two trachea of band and upstream air bag 1 and downstream air bag 2, described upstream air bag 1 and described downstream air bag 2 lay respectively at the upstream and downstream of tested limb artery blood flow, after binding, described upstream air bag 1 is fixed on wrist pulse upstream and blocks measured's elbow arterial blood flow, and be connected with the upstream balloon interface on described main frame 4, described downstream air bag 2 is fixed on the downstream portion detection wrist beat pulse in arterial blood flow direction and is connected with the downstream balloon interface on described main frame 4, described downstream air bag 2 is for detecting the change information of pulse signal, the change of the blood flow pulse that real-time sensing is changed by the pressure of described upstream air bag 1 and produces, the interpersonal interactive interface comprising keyboard and display that described main frame 4 comprises a microprocessor and is connected with described microprocessor, described main frame 4 also comprises air pump 6, gas bleeder valve 7, described main frame 4 also comprises the first pressure transducer 3 and the second pressure transducer 5, described first pressure transducer 3 and the second pressure transducer 5 are connected respectively or simultaneously by one or two of gas UNICOM parts and described upstream air bag 1 and described downstream air bag 2, described air pump 6 is the air pump 6 that at least one is inflated for one or two in described upstream air bag 1 and described downstream air bag 2, described gas bleeder valve 7 is for one or two in described upstream air bag 1 and described downstream air bag 2 at a slow speed or the gas bleeder valve 7 of quick air releasing, air pump 6 described in described Microprocessor S3C44B0X, gas bleeder valve 7 and process detect the force value in one or two in described upstream air bag 1 and described downstream air bag 2 respectively or simultaneously by one or two in the first pressure transducer 3 and the second pressure transducer 5, pulse signal, or force value and pulse signal.
In described microprocessor, be provided with control and data processor, described control and handling procedure perform the blood pressure measurement comprised the following steps:
A) described downstream air bag 2 is pressurized to a force value between tested systolic arterial pressure and diastolic pressure, or the mean blood pressure value of tested tremulous pulse subtracts 10mmHg and average pressure value and adds a force value between 20mmHg, or a force value, makes the pulse signal amplitude detected in described downstream air bag 2 when this force value be greater than a set-point;
B) upstream air bag 1 is pressurized to a force value higher than tested systolic arterial pressure;
C) upstream air bag 1 is slowly lost heart, in upstream air bag 1 slowly bleeding process, the air pressure of constantly change in upstream air bag 1 is measured by the first pressure transducer 3, and the pulse signal measured by the second pressure transducer 5 in downstream air bag 2, according to the relation between the air pressure in described pulse signal and described upstream air bag 1, determine tested systolic arterial pressure.
Scheme one: as shown in Fig. 3 and 6-7, uses decompression method to detect double bolloon pulse signal and systolic pressure, comprises the steps:
1) by a fan-shaped cuff of double bolloon, or the non-fan-shaped cuff of a double bolloon, or two joining cufves, or two not joining cufves are bound on tested limbs, wherein upstream air bag 1 and downstream air bag 2 lay respectively at the upstream and downstream of limb artery blood flow, and are connected with the upstream balloon interface on main frame 4 and downstream balloon interface with downstream trachea 10 respectively by upstream trachea 9 with downstream air bag 2 by upstream air bag 1;
2) press the start key of main frame 4 keyboard, the second gas bleeder valve cuts out, and the downward faint breath capsule 2 of the second air pump is inflated, and the air pressure of downstream air bag 2 slowly increases from zero;
3) this step has 4 kinds of embodiments, respectively as step 3-1), 3-2), 3-3) and 3-4):
3-1) in the process that downstream air bag 2 is pressurizeed, pulse signal in real-time detection downstream air bag 2, when described pulse signal amplitude is increased to maximum, when then starting to decline by zero, stop pressurization, now downstream air bag 2 is pressurized to a force value between tested systolic arterial pressure and diastolic pressure;
3-2) in the process that downstream air bag 2 is pressurizeed, pulse signal in real-time detection downstream air bag 2, when described pulse signal amplitude is increased to maximum by zero, when then starting to decline, stop pressurization, the mean blood pressure value that now downstream air bag 2 is pressurized to tested tremulous pulse subtracts 10mmHg and average pressure value and adds a force value between 20mmHg;
3-3) in the process that downstream air bag 2 is pressurizeed, pulse signal in real-time detection downstream air bag 2, when described pulse signal amplitude by zero be increased to be greater than set-point time, stop pressurization, described pulse signal amplitude set-point is a value between 1.3mmHg to 1.8mmHg, and preferred pulse signal amplitude set-point is 1.5mmHg;
3-4) downstream air bag 2 segmentation is pressurizeed, and after each section of pressurization terminates, detect the pulse signal in downstream air bag 2, when described pulse signal amplitude is greater than set-point, stop pressurization, the described segmented objects to downstream air bag 2 segmentation pressurization is 80mmHg, 120mmHg, 160mmHg, 200mmHg, described pulse signal amplitude set-point is a value between 1.3mmHg to 1.8mmHg, and preferred pulse signal amplitude set-point is 1.5mmHg;
4) the first gas bleeder valve cuts out, and the first air pump upstream air bag 1 is inflated, and upstream air bag 1 pressure increases from zero;
5) this step has 2 kinds of embodiments, respectively as step 5-1) and 5-2):
5-1) in the process that upstream air bag 1 is pressurizeed, the change of the pulse signal amplitude in Real-Time Monitoring downstream air bag 2, instantly the pulse signal amplitude in faint breath capsule 2 with the increase of the air pressure of upstream air bag 1 from diminishing greatly, when finally disappearing, stop pressurization, now upstream air bag 1 is pressurized to a force value higher than tested systolic arterial pressure;
5-2) upstream air bag 1 segmentation is pressurizeed, the described segmented objects to upstream air bag 1 segmentation pressurization is 180mmHg, 240mmHg, 280mmHg, and after each section of pressurization terminates, detect the pulse signal in downstream air bag 2, after described pulse signal disappears, stop pressurization, now upstream air bag 1 is pressurized to a force value higher than tested systolic arterial pressure;
6) the first gas bleeder valve is controlled, upstream air bag 1 is slowly lost heart, in upstream air bag 1 slowly bleeding process, the air pressure of constantly change in upstream air bag 1 is measured by the first pressure transducer 3, and measure the pulse signal in downstream air bag 2 by the second pressure transducer, according to the air pressure in described pulse signal and upstream air bag 1, determine tested systolic arterial pressure, describedly determine that the method for tested systolic arterial pressure has 2 kinds, respectively as step 6-1) and 6-2):
6-1) in upstream air bag 1 slowly bleeding process, the air pressure of constantly change in upstream air bag 1 is measured by the first pressure transducer 3, and the time of origin of first pulse signal in downstream air bag 2 is detected by the second pressure transducer 5, according to the air pressure in the upstream air bag 1 when described first pulse signal occurs, determine tested systolic arterial pressure, such as, measure the generation moment of the peak value of first pulse signal in the downstream air bag 2 detected, with the atmospheric pressure value measured at the generation moment upstream air bag 1 of the peak value of described first pulse signal, the atmospheric pressure value of described upstream air bag 1 is tested systolic arterial pressure, or the atmospheric pressure value measured at the generation moment upstream air bag 1 of the peak value of described first pulse signal, with the meansigma methods of the atmospheric pressure value of upstream air bag 1 in former and later two moment pulse cycles in the generation moment of the peak value at described first pulse signal, described meansigma methods is tested systolic arterial pressure,
6-2) in upstream air bag 1 slowly bleeding process, the air pressure of constantly change in upstream air bag 1 is measured by the first pressure transducer 3, and amplitude and the time of origin of first and second pulse signal in downstream air bag 2 is measured by the second pressure transducer 5, with the atmospheric pressure value in the upstream air bag 1 when first and second pulse signal occur, determine tested arterial blood systolic pressure.Such as, measure the amplitude A 4 of first and second pulse signal and time of origin t4 and t5 of A5 and peak value in the downstream air bag 2 detected, with two atmospheric pressure value P4 and P5 of measurement in the time of origin t4 and t5 upstream air bag 1 of the peak value of described first and second pulse signal, then tested systolic arterial pressure is (P5-(P5-P4) * A5/ (A5-A4)).
8) open the first gas bleeder valve and the second gas bleeder valve, lose heart to upstream air bag 1 and downstream air bag 2.
As in Fig. 6, t0-t4 is shown as this device detects systolic pressure pulse signal sequential chart by decompression method.
